Welcome to Business Banking. With us, you’ll take part in supporting start-ups as well as larger corporates in our market. Your skills, passion for customers and unique background are what we need to provide the financial solutions of tomorrow. We serve, advise and partner with corporate customers, covering all their business needs through a full range of services, including payments, cash management, cards, working capital management and finance solutions.
Business Banking Tønsberg/Drammen is part of Region East, geographically surrounding the Oslo-area. As a Graduate you’ll be a part of one of our teams servicing large and mid-size corporate customers with the full scale of products offered by Nordea. The teams located in the abovementioned locations are responsible for the total income and profitability, customer satisfaction, credit risk, and serving the customers in collaboration with all the product responsible units in Nordea. Region East is a fast-growing region and we aim to expand our market share even further.
What you’ll be doing:
You will join Business Banking Viken Vest, based in Tønsberg and Drammen, where we serve corporate customers in Buskerud and Vestfold/Telemark with the full scale of products offered by Nordea. Reporting to Branch Manager in Viken Vest, but also supporting Head of Region East.
In your daily work you will function in a role as Relationship Manager with responsibilities as:
- Credit Analysis and screening of new customer cases
- Participating in customer dialogue and meetings
- Working in a highly motivated team of employees striving to increase Nordea’s customer satisfaction and income
- Collaborating with all supporting units (credit, corporate support etc) and all Product Responsible Units, as well as other branches in Region East
- Work with stakeholders across Nordea to secure profitability and sustained growth, by optimising business results and customer satisfaction
- Support business decisions, product and service development, and marketing by delivering customer insight analytics
- Support Product Managers with product management activities such as creating marketing material, internal communication, profit and loss monitoring, and writing product roadmaps and strategy
